NATURAL GAS: $5.956/MMBtu, down 1.5 cents
Natural gas prices inched down in early trading as forecasts called for slightly higher temperatures in the northern US.
RBOB: $1.1507/gal, up 4.02 cents
Reformulated gasoline blendstock for oxygenate blending (RBOB) futures prices climbed higher alongside the upswing in the crude oil market.
BENZENE: January benzene barges were talked in a wider range of 83-96 cents/gal FOB (free on board), compared with 89-95 cents/gal assessed on 29 December.

PROPYLENE: No refinery-grade propylene (RGP) spot activity was heard on Monday. RGP for January was offered on 2 January at 20 cents/lb. RGP last traded on 17 December at 13 cents/lb.
